Top Definition
A female who derives sexual pleasure from rubbing against others in crowded places; for example, a commuter train or in line for Star Wars.
Man, that fricatrix back there polished my watch real nice, but I got no fuckin' arm hair left.
by M. Kenny May 09, 2005

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.